The following notes from a Block by Block insider. As previously reported all the security ambassadors under Block by Block received a mass termination notice. In Thursday’s meeting General Manager of Block by Block, Erica Leon, along with Danny Rivas, Director of Community Safety for the City of West Hollywood informed ambassadors that they can re-apply for their jobs, except Leon she would be staying with the new company and would retain favorite staff. A class-action lawsuit against the company and the City of West Hollywood is under consideration.

Erica Leon graduated from the Fashion Institute of Design and Merchandising in 2003 with a major in fashion design and merchandising. From 2006-2013 Leon was the Southwest Territory Manager for Addidas. In 2016 Leon became a Store District Manager for the Starbucks organization overseeing 23 locations in the Los Angeles area. From 2016 -2023 Leon was Director of Operations for Rumba Room Live, where she streamlined concert and event ticketing and coordinated talent booking. In Dec. 2022 through August 2023 (9 months) Leon worked with the Clean, Safety, Hospitality, and Outreach Programs in Downtown Santa Monica. In August 2023 Leon was named the General Manager of the City of West Hollywood’s Block by Block Security Ambassador Program.
